| Not Ranked : 0 score As of right now, your best bet is the TWM Desert Eagle...its about 1.32lbs iirc....everybody who owns one says its a very nice piece and well worth the $100 spent the RKM one is 2lbs...which is a small plus over the TWM, given our sloppy stock shifter...but it is almost 7 months over due....who knows when this thing will ever come out If you cannot wait any longer, get the TWM on another side note...if you are looking to improve your shifting...the medieval side motor mounts make shifting much crisper and positive....before i added them to my car...I would mis or grind 3rd gear alot...they say its natural design of the MS3 because the engine hops around so much during acceleration.....after I added the mounts, I have yet to mis or grind 3rd....amazing |

| Not Ranked : 0 score Any transmission mount will be loud when installed because the bushing is not a cushioned rubber piece as the stocker is. You will have increased NVH with the mounts but they do improve shifting drastically. Both the TRZ and Medieval mounts are a great option, but I can work you a better deal on the TRZ -Jeff at PG

| Not Ranked : 0 score There you go, we have not found a reason for the heavy knob. After going light weight and removing over 1/2 the shifter weight at the trans the car shifts a bunch better. I have used the stocker and out light weight unit (see link http://www.mazdaspeedforum.org/forum/foru...one-130-a.html) and to be honest, the light weight is preferred by everyone who has driven the car. To each there own but for performance, I am sticking with the LW option. |
